Volkswagen (XTRA:VOW3) is in advanced talks with JSW Group about a potential partnership or sale of its India operations. The discussions focus on transferring control of Volkswagen’s India unit to JSW while retaining access to manufacturing assets. Recent official comments indicate there is currently no finalized agreement and negotiations remain ongoing. STORY: :: Thousands of Audi workers protest the proposed closure of a factory as the car maker battles headwinds:: Neckarsulm, Germany / July 29, 2026:: Anton Sale, Audi worker"Clarity. Everyone is worried about their job and our plant—a place into which we’ve poured our heart and soul. We want it to survive; we want our jobs to remain secure. We want our families to be able to live and for us to earn a living. That is what we want.":: German carmakers are under pressure from the costly shift to electric vehicles, competition from China and U.S. tariffsAudi's Neckarsulm plant in south-west Germany is one of four German plants belonging to Volkswagen threatened with possible closure after 2030, as the group battles high costs, rising competition from China and tariff headwinds.Neckarsulm currently operates at an annual production capacity of 225,000, around 75,000 below previous years.The company has also agreed to cut the night shift at the site, which produces exclusively combustion-engine cars. Volkswagen and other German car manufacturers like Mercedes-Benz MBG have already struck agreements to cut tens of thousands of workers.
STORY: BMW has joined the growing list of Germany's automakers who are planning to slash their workforces by thousands.The sector is under pressure from the costly shift to electric vehicles, intense competition from China and U.S. tariffs.BMW said on Wednesday it will cut several thousand jobs in Germany by the end of 2027 under a voluntary redundancy program.According to a person familiar with the matter, the total workforce is expected to shrink by around 8,000.The Munich-based group currently employs about 150,000 people worldwide.BMW, formerly seen as a somewhat steady hand among its peers, cut its profit outlook in June for the current year.It cited weaker-than-expected business in China, where vehicle sales have fallen sharply in recent months.Its CEO subsequently said the business would accelerate and intensify ongoing cost-cutting efforts.Volkswagen and Mercedes-Benz have already struck agreements to cut tens of thousands of workers.Sports car maker Porsche and Audi, both part of the Volkswagen Group, have ramped up restructuring plans.Workers protested on Wednesday at an Audi plant threatened with closure.A source said BMW's CEO warned of a challenging time ahead.But said the measures were important to ensure BMW becomes more profitable.
Car-shopping marketplace Cars.com™ (NYSE: CARS) today released its 2026 Best Cars for Car Seats report, compiled by certified child passenger safety technicians and based on 12 months of hands-on testing. Out of 56 vehicles tested, only the 2025 Mercedes-Benz GLS580 and the 2026 Volkswagen Tiguan received straight A's across every car seat category. Ten additional vehicles were named Top Finishers, each earning A's in every category but one.
